Infinity Natural Resources, Inc. (INR) Misses Q1 EPS by 124c, provides capital and production guidance

Infinity Natural Resources, Inc. (NYSE: INR) reported Q1 EPS of ($0.35), $1.24 worse than the analyst estimate of $0.89. Revenue for the quarter came in at $154.87 million.
2026 Capital & Production Guidance
Infinity is reaffirming its 2026 capital & production guidance from its fourth quarter earnings press release. Infinity’s capital budget for 2026 is $450 million to $500 million related to development activities, including D&C and midstream. Net production is expected to be between 345 and 375 MMcfe/d for 2026, with natural gas expected to be between 235 and 255 MMcfe/d and oil and liquids expected to be between 18 and 20 Mbbls/d.
